[ARCHIVED] Man Arrested for Gunpoint Street Robbery

At 12:35 a.m. this morning, August 30, Eugene Police officers responded to a report of a robbery at gunpoint near 250 W. Broadway. The victims reported their skateboards were stolen by the suspect, who got out of his car and used a gun during the robbery.


The suspect was described to police and had left the scene in a compact sedan with a bicycle on the roof. Police found the car at Safeway, 18th and High, a few minutes later. They conducted a high-risk stop at 24th and Portland and the suspect, later identified as Nathan Alan Duffy, age 30, was not following commands. He repeatedly refused commands to get on his knees and a Taser was used to take him into custody safely. Police recovered property and two realistic-looking replica handguns.


Duffy was charged with Robbery in the First Degree, DUII, Possession of Cocaine, Possession of Schedule 1 Drugs (mushrooms).
